Алгоритм дейкстры пример java

 

 

 

 

В коллекции есть серьёзные вещи: алгоритм Дейкстры (Java) или вейвлет Хаара, а также просто интересные примеры кода, как игра «Змейка» (C). Java Sort Algorithm 3. Re: Dijkstra algorithm. Если нужны примеры алгоритмов с графами на Java - инет полон ими (пусть не на java, а на том же самом С/С -переделать даже проще, чем с Джавы на Си) .Исходник алгортма Дейкстры удачно скопирован с httpFile: Dijkstra.java Author: Keith Schwarz (htiekcs.stanford.edu) An implementation of Dijkstras single-source shortest path algorithm.For HashMap. Sieve of Eratosthenes in O(NloglogN). i know little of java that is why i thought this was advanced for me, didnt know it was beggers codes. Алгоритм Дейкстры объяснения Java. Всем привет, столкнулась с такой проблемой, есть алгоритм для нахождения миним. The Java Program: Dijkstra.java.

Алгоритм Дейкстры известен как алгоритм кратчайшего пути с одним источником.Ниже приведен пример Java для решения алгоритма кратчайшего пути Дейкстры с использованием code.i-harness.com > algorithm Алгоритм Дейкстры |. Программирование, Алгоритмы, С, C, Java, Python и другие вещи.(пример взят с википедии), трейты указываются через запятуюАлгоритм Дейкстры предназначен для нахождения расстояния в графе. Волновой алгоритм.40. Алгоритм A-Star (A). Java 16 августа 2015 Автор статьиВ процессе работы алгоритма Дейкстры поддерживается множество , состоящие из вершин орграфа , для которых кратчайшее расстояние уже найдено.Пример. 7 2. Алгоритм Дейкстры - C. public class DijkstraHeap .

Алгоритм Дейксты — это весьма элегантный способ нахождения кратчайшего пути сквозь любою сеть с возможностью задавать конкретный вес для каждой из дуг. есть дерево которое отражает лабиринт, в нем есть циклы, необходимо найти кратчайший путь от одной произвольнойСпасибо! з.ы. Сортировка 1. import java.util. Алгоритм Дейкстры (англ. Хорошо подходит для реализации алгоритма Дейкстры: индекс номер вершины. Пример на YouTube. Данный алгоритм является алгоритмом на графах, который изобретен нидерландским ученым Э. Постановка задачи.

Пример 1.1.Рис. Вопрос, если честно, просто идиотский. Помогите, пожалуйста, распаралелить алгоритм Дейкстры. Dijkstras algorithm) — алгоритм на графах, изобретённый нидерландским учёным Эдсгером Дейкстрой в 1959 году. Классическая реализация алгоритма A на языке Java. Даёт возможность посетить меньше вершин. Пример. 1.1. Цель: изучить синтаксис языка программирования Java и реализовать алгоритм Дейкстры (нахождение длины минимальных путей от одной вершины до всех остальныхПример работы алгоритма. Удобнее всего реализовывать этот алгоритм на языке Java, поскольку она содержит стандартную длиннуюлежат. public class Node .Алгоритм Дейкстры (англ. public class DijkstraAlgorithm .Как засечь время выполнения метода в Java? 1 подписчик. Подготовка. Нахождение кратчайших путей от заданной вершины до всех остальных вершин алгоритмом Дейкстры. Алгоритм Дейкстры 2. Рассмотрим шаг алгоритма Дейкстры для нашего примера. Алгоритм Дейкстры продолжается до тех пор, пока все доступные из s вершины не будут исследованы.Пример коллекций на Java. ЗлостныйКодер. Найти кратчайшие пути от центра города до каждого города области. остовного дерева, мне нужно максимального вот код алгоритма Прима: [JAVA] import java.util.. Её соседямиimport java.io.BufferedReader import java.io.IOException import java.io.InputStreamReader import java.io.PrintWriter import java.util.ArrayList import java.util.Arrays Я подобрал для вас темы с ответами на вопрос Алгоритм Дейкстра(PriorityQueue) ( Java SE)вот пример матрицы, записать в array.dat, при запуске вводим начальную вершину и конечную, минимальное растояние выводит правильно.Алгоритм Дейкстры Builder pattern - Javahostciti.net//algoritm-deyksttern--java.htmlДали задание реализовать паттерн Builder для алгоритма Дейкстры, что бы объект Graph был immutable, и были методы нахождения кратчайшего пути.Главная IT Вопросы Java Алгоритм Дейкстры Builder pattern - Java. Откуда: Сообщений: 3. Поэтому я решил написать свой парсер, используя Алгоритм Дейкстры для преобразования входной записи из инфиксной нотации в постфиксную, также известный, как АлгоритмОчень удобный Java-класс, не пришлось писать свой. Связаные спискиПример кода в файле MyGdxGame. B-дерево 4. Реализация алгоритма Гарнера. Поиск кратчайшего пути, улучшение алгоритма Дейкстры. Алгоритм Дейкстры применяется в предположении. Алгоритм Дейкстры позволяет найти кратчайшие пути от данной вершины до всех остальных вершин в графе.Реализация алгоритма Дейкстры с RMQ на Java Пример алгоритма Дейкстры (продолжение). Dijkstras algorithm) — алгоритм на графах, изобретённый нидерландским ученым Э. И далее запускаем основной цикл алгоритма. Шаги алгоритма Дейкстры удобно оформлять в таблице, каждый столбец которой соответствует вершине графа. неотрицательности длин дуг исходного графа. Ниже приведен пример Java для решения алгоритма кратчайшего пути Дейкстры с использованием матрицы смежности. Обратите внимание, что каждый узел установлен на игровом поле хаотично.Проблема с алгоритмом Дейкстра. Некоторые дороги односторонние. Алгоритм Дейкстры. Assembler [4]. This article presents a Java implementation of this algorithm. Дейкстрой в 1959 году. Работа Шварца только началась. Сортированные бинарные деревья и Бинарный поиск 3. public final class Dijkstra / Given a directed, weighted graph G and a source node s, produces the distances from s to each Пример реализации на Java. can you guys help me run the codes? The Price of all Learn Spring Security course packages will permanently increase by 50 on Friday: >>> GET ACCESS NOW. Очень хорошая статья про equals в классах-родителя Сортировка слиянием. Констaнция Member. class ShortestPath . import java.util.regex.Matcher import java.util.regex.Pattern программирование на Java. При увеличении их количества задача поиска кратчайшего пути усложняется. Java Algorithms 2. javatalks - Форум Java программистовФорум Java программистовjavatalks.ru / 2006 - currentyear javatalks.ru551200true.Пусть мы ищем Алгоритмом Дейкстры минимальные пути (по обратным весам) в этом изменённом графе из точки A. Dijkstras algorithm) — алгоритм на графах, изобретённый нидерландским учёным Эдсгером Дейкстрой в 1959 году. SSE Instructions.Dijkstras algorithm in O(E logV). Алгоритм сортировочной станции. код пишу на java если будут примеры. Java Shell Sort 71. Эдсгер Дейкстра назвал его именно так из-за сходства в принципе действий с обычной железнодорожной .Очень удобный Java-класс, не пришлось писать свой. Алгоритм Дейкстра прекрасно работает, но имеет недостаток - он не использует Превратим обход в ширину в алгоритм Дейкстры за (n log(n) m log(n))!Приводить примеры я не буду, потому что это сделать не сложно, зная принцип работы алгоритма. Sorry guys but i need to get this algorithm working. Пример применения алгоритма Дейкстры. Алгоритм Дейкстры (англ. Пример 3.1.Чтобы найти величину минимального пути и сам путь от вершины до вершины с помощью алгоритма Дейкстры, построим орграф, у которого к каждой дуге припишем ее вес. import java.util. Цель: Изучить идею разделения задачи на составные части на примере алгоритма Merge sort.Цель: Познакомиться с теорией графов и алгоритмом Дейкстры для нахождения кратчайшего пути между двумя точками. Вообще идей нету как это можно сделать. The emphasis in this article is the shortest path problem (SPP), being one of the fundamental theoretic problems known in graph theory Алгоритм Дейкстры (англ. Posted 11 November 2008 - 01:50 AM. Минимальную метку имеет вершина 1. Дана сеть автомобильных дорог, соединяющих области города. Измерение скорости на головоломке 15.Алгоритмы A и Дейкстры являются классическими примерами алгоритмов перемещения в порядке ухудшения. Доброго времени суток! Нужна Ваша помощь.можете, пожалуйста, показать самый простой пример программы реализации алгоритма RSA не нашла на форуме простых примеров Графы, алгоритм Прима (Дейкстры-Прима) [new]. Т.е. Находит кратчайшие пути от одной из вершин графа до всех остальных. "Это очень легко!" — скажете вы. Строки таблицы соответствуют повторению общего шага. import java.lang. Приведенная выше анимация является типичным примером работы этого алгоритма. Требования к проекту 10 2.1 Требования к реализации алгоритма. Stacks and Queues 4. Overview. 35. Почему это работает.Имея псевдокод алгоритма Дейкстры, рассмотрим Java-код этого алгоритма для ненаправленного графа с положительными целочисленными значениями веса. Java Recursion 6. Блок-схема алгоритма Дейкстры. Дано: несколько текстовых файлов, строки в них отсортированы. Рассмотрим пример нахождение кратчайшего пути. Дейкстрой в 1959 году. Dijkstras algorithm) — алгоритм на графах, изобретённый нидерландским учёным Эдсгером Дейкстрой в 1959 году.Алгоритм Дейкстры. В нескольких местах вы Dijkstras Algorithms describes how to find the shortest path from one node to another node in a directed weighted graph. 1. / Java Program for Dijkstra Single Source Shortest Path Algorithm.dijkstrasAlgorithm.dijkstraalgorithm(adjacencymatrix, source) System.out.println("The Shorted Path to all nodes are ") Кто подскажет как правильно должен работать алгоритм Дейкстры при обходе дерева с циклами. Замечание. я нашел для реализации dijkstras алгоритм на Интернет и было интересно, если кто-то может помочь мне понять, как работает код.Dijkstras Algorithm explanation java. Код программ на Паскаль и C. В противном случае возвращаемся к пятому шагу. Алгоритмы на ассме.const int N 6 / Реализация алгоритма Дейкстры. import java.io. Linked List in Java 5. В статье (октябрь 2016 года) господин Мартин демонстрирует искусство TDD на примере алгоритма Дейкстры.package dijkstrasAlg import org.junit.Test import java.util. Пример алгоритма Дейкстры.Пример алгоритма Дейкстры. И далее запускаем основной цикл алгоритма. 1 public class Dijkstra 2 3 // Dijkstras algorithm to find shortest path from s to all other nodes 4 public static int [] dijkstra (WeightedGraph G, int s) 5 final int [] dist new int [G.size()] // shortest known distance from "s" 6 final int [] pred new int [G.size Алгоритм поиска A. Dijkstras algorithm with priorityqueue or set in O(E logV). Java: PriorityQueue Вариант реализации: binary heap. PriorityQueue в Java.return min Пример использования: слияние потоков. Находит кратчайшие пути от одной из вершин графа до всех остальных.

Также рекомендую прочитать: